A meeting opportunity between the customer and the producer
The market is an opportunity to meet friends and neighbours! Nothing better than to talk with the producer to discover his work and his know-how, to learn about the secret of his products, or even… to get the best recipe to highlight them!
A market for local producers
The market is also an opportunity to have access to fresh, local, seasonal and quality products. It’s an opportunity to choose products that haven’t been transported long distances, so you’re reducing your carbon footprint. By prioritizing local agriculture, you also invest in the local economy. These are good reasons to come and meet the merchants.
